Welcome aboard! One thing you'll hit early: we're mid-upgrade on Burrowpike, our message broker, moving from the v3 cluster to v4. The big gotcha is that v4 changes the ack semantics, so consumers written for v3 can double-process messages if you just repoint them. We migrate one queue at a time, always with a shadow consumer running first. Don't upgrade anything solo in your first month — pair with someone who's done a queue already. The full migration playbook and queue status tracker are on the page below.

wiki page, tahaf-tajog: https://jira.ordindyn.corp/pipeline

## Timetabler: Data Stores

Hey security folks — the Timetabler solver for the Brackenfield school district keeps its constraint sets and generated schedules in one Postgres database. No student PII lives here, just room codes, period slots, and anonymized teacher IDs. Writes happen only during the nightly solve window; everything else is read-only. Worth auditing the role grants, honestly. For your review, the service connects with the connection string below.

replica DSN, yahaf-yagaf: mongodb://tamath_svc:a2netSk3RZMuTj@db-d084.novacsoft.internal:5432/ralmir

## Further reading

Before you review the dark-mode changes to the Ledgerlite admin dashboard, a bit of context helps. We don't hardcode colors anywhere anymore — everything goes through the theme tokens defined in the styles package, and the toggle just swaps the root attribute. The tricky bits are charts and third-party embeds, which need explicit overrides; you'll see a few of those in this PR. If something looks hacky, it's probably documented as a known limitation. The full token reference and theming guidelines live at:

dashboard of kafof-tahaf = https://confluence.tolvaqsys.internal/projects/browse/display/a1250987